切忌浮躁,这是为了提醒自己罗马不是一天建成的。
为什么要切忌浮躁呢?
因为学习这件事,并不是一学就能理解,能够应用的。
就拿昨天发现快速排序自己不记得这件事,今天我去尝试写快速排序算法,发现漏洞百出,甚至对自己产生怀疑。
我意识到这样发展下去,就是破罐子破摔,我立马踩了刹车,告诉自己切忌浮躁。
在心态调整过程中,我一直对自己写不出快速排序这件事迈不过去。
自己明明弄清楚了原理,画了图,写了代码,但还是写不出来。是自己比较笨,还是不够努力,还是方法不对。
如果是我比较笨的话,其实也没有什么办法改变。
如果是不够努力的话,这是可以改变的,就是多写几次。
如果是方法不对的话,这是可以改变的,就是去找更好的方法。
就这样一步步调整好了心态,去重新学习快速排序算法,然后调整了学习《数据结构与算法之美》的预期。
在写的过程中,回忆起之前写快速排序算法,更多的时候自己是通过记忆来写,而不是通过理解来写。
简单来说,就是理解不够记忆来凑。
而这里的“记忆”指的是是短期记忆,一段时间后就会遗忘。
分析到这里改进方向也就差不多了,一方面主动去加强理解,一方面去将短期记忆转化为长期记忆。
不过最关键的还是切忌浮躁,心一急就会为了进度,而忽略质量。